The North School

Main information

Type of service: Day schools, Schools

The Laurel Centre is a Specialist Resourced Provision located within The North School, a mainstream mixed 11-19 high school. Students within the Laurel Centre have a disgnosis of ASD and a statement of special educational needs or education, health and care plan. Students are placed within the provision by the Local Authority. This unit is for students who require a high level of specialist support to be able to access learning in a mainstream environment.

Eligibility

Age: From age 11 to 19

Aimed at: Adolescent , Adult , Child

Registrations & Approaches

Specialisms: Exclusively autism specific

Other specialisms: Learning disability
